Our license agreements provide for an annual royalty of 0.25% of certain consumer, business and content revenues, subject
to a minimum annual royalty, subject to inflationary adjustments, of £8.5 million in relation to our consumer operations, and £1.5
million in relation to our business operations.
Under the agreements we have worldwide exclusivity over the name “Virgin Media” and “Virgin Media Inc.” We are also
licensed to use the name “Virgin Media Business” for the provision of business communications services.
Properties
We own and lease administrative facilities, operational network facilities, and retail facilities throughout the U.K. We lease
our U.K. headquarters in Hook, Hampshire.
We own or lease the fixed assets necessary for the operation of our businesses, including office space, transponder space,
headend facilities, rights of way, cable television and telecommunications distribution equipment, telecommunications switches
and customer premises equipment and other property necessary for our operations. The physical components of our broadband
network require maintenance and periodic upgrades to support the new services and products we introduce. Subject to these
maintenance and upgrade activities, our management believes that our current facilities are suitable and adequate for our business
operations for the foreseeable future.
Employees
At December 31, 2013, we had a total of 14,259 employees. The number of full-time equivalent employees at December 31,
2013 was 8.9% less than at June 30, 2013, principally due to organizational changes implemented following completion of the
LG/VM Transaction. There are no employees at Virgin Media covered by collective bargaining or recognition agreements. For
employee consultation purposes, we work with and recognize our National and Divisional Employee Voice Forums. We believe
we have a good relationship with our workforce.
